当前位置:当前位置: 首页 >
为什么零知识证明(ZKP)领域的开源项目几乎都用Rust实现?
人气:发表时间:2025-06-22 00:05:16
ZKP作为一个复杂的密码学应用,其底层还是建立在其他的building block/primitive上的,所谓问题还是为什么很多密码学得库都逐渐改成了Rust实现。
当然作为补充,Golang实现的ZKP系统也不少,最广为使用的就是 gnark 。
用Rust实现密码学库,一个非常典型的好处就是类型安全 。
例如u32变量,其所有计算都是良好定义的,例如2个u32的加法,如果在某一处出现了溢出的可能性,编译期间就会被发现。
从而迫使你使用checked_add,overflow…。
同类文章排行
- Swift 和同时代的其他语言比起来怎么样?
- 有没有什么惊为天人的 Logo 设计?
- 如何看待英伟达新推出的显卡5090dd?
- 三亚女游客毒蛇咬伤致死***暴露了我国什么问题?
- 为什么电脑厂商用了二十多年时间才发现电源应该放在机箱下部?电源下置这么显而易见的结构这么晚才出现?
- 为什么编程语言百花齐放,Web 标记语言 HTML 一家独大?
- 小沈阳女儿韩国出道,将发行个人首张迷你专辑,为什么选择韩国出道?你看好吗?
- 多地查摆年轻干部玩心重混日子等问题,如何看待此事?是否能推动干部作风建设?
- 为什么中国主机带宽比美国贵5倍(原来错误的10000倍),比如阿里云?
- 想学编程,该不该买MacBook?
最新资讯文章
- lar***el是php架构最垃圾的性能,为什么那么多人还是自我感觉良好?
- 男朋友说我穿衣服太开放,难道好身材不应该显示出来吗?
- 用J***a写Android的时代是不是要结束了?
- duckdb的性能如何?
- 北京日报点名批评“苏超”过度娱乐化的动机是什么?
- 商城里如何缓存商品信息?
- 俗话说“女人三十如狼四十如虎”,到底是不是真的??
- 你认为这次伊以冲突,以色列这次干得漂亮吗?
- 为什么 IPv6 在国内至今未得以大规模应用?
- Trae和Cursor对比有什么优势吗?
- 张伟丽可以打败什么级别的普通男性?
- 有人说x86是条必沉的船,苹果早就跳船了,微软也有弃船的意图,你怎么看?
- 如何评价字节跳动开源的 HTTP 框架 Hertz ?
- 前端,后端,全栈哪个好找工作?
- 现在网上把清朝说得一无是处,但是为什么能统治268年?
- 以色列为什么要打伊朗?
- 你的亲戚提过什么过分的要求?
- 如何评价仓颉编程语言7月30日开源?
- 世界上哪款战斗机最好看?
- 王健林再卖 48 座万达广场,会对万达集团带来哪些影响?目前万达面临怎样的困境?